What's really going on with Justin Bieber as singer continues to spark waves of concern

Justin Bieber hasn’t produced a studio album in five years since he released Justice, to the world, but the Baby hitmaker has remained in the public eye - and not always for the right reasons.
Why? People online are saying they are concerned. Bieber has had quite the yo-yo year, with the birth of his first child, followed by scrutiny and speculation over the P Diddy drama, followed by incessant divorce rumours.
These divorce rumours haven’t been helped by the fact that a “glitch” (in Hailey Bieber’s words) means that Justin and Hailey keep unfollowing each other on Instagram.
Moreover, fans of Bieber’s ex-girlfriend Selena Gomez have now got involved, claiming that Bieber posting cryptic Gollum from Lord of The Rings memes on Instagram is actually a reference to Selena Gomez’s engagement to record producer Benny Blanco.
The clip, which was shared to his Instagram story, showed a clip of Gollum as he finally regains control of the One Ring, just before he is cast into the flames of Mordor. The caption of the meme, made by an unknown creator, was: “Girls on social media when they get engaged,” leading many to believe it’s in reference to Gomez’s engagement to Blanco, who was once a friend of Bieber, in December 2024.
Fans also think Bieber is wearing this baggage on his face, with appearances around New York prompting an increased level of worry from onlookers, as the singer looks undeniably gaunt and dishevelled.
And then there’s his online persona, which fluctuates between cogent and concerningly zany. Bieber recently posted a video of him and a friend rapping on a private jet about getting “high.” Bieber, who is topless and holding an open bag of popcorn, raps: “High like a fly guy, I fly high like a magpie, I go high like I’m that guy.”

The video was posted less than two days after representatives for Justin Bieber and his wife Hailey issued a joint statement denying that Justin is taking any illegal drugs and calling the public’s obsession over the singer’s mental and physical health “exhausting and pitiful”.
“[It] shows that despite the obvious truth, people are committed to keeping negative, salacious, harmful narratives alive,” the statement says.
The reps added that the last year was “very transformative for [Justin] as he ended several close friendships and business relationships that no longer served him.” The statement also claimed Bieber has been busy working on new music and parenting his and Hailey’s newborn son.
New York appearances send mixed messages about Bieber’s mental state
In February, Bieber was snapped by paparazzi while entering a bath house spa during a trip to NYC while wearing a pale yellow hoodie with no shirt underneath, a rolled up mint green beanie and baggy trousers that exposed his boxers.
His strangely-outfitted appearance came amid the swirling divorce rumours that are surrounding him and wife Hailey Bieber, even though the couple also stepped out later that day to have dinner together in New York.

These rumours were kick-started by the revelation that Bieber had unfollowed Hailey Bieber on Instagram in January, which is apparently as good as filing divorce papers in Hollywood circles.
However, Bieber later took to Instagram Stories to clarify that someone had hacked into his account and unfollowed his wife, saying that things were “getting suss out here.”
In the most recent controversy, Bieber was seen squaring up with paparazzi - this time across the States in Palm Springs, California, where he is currently situated ahead of Coachella.
In a video obtained by TMZ, Bieber was heading to get coffee with friends when he first spotted the photographers.
One withed Bieber a good morning, before the hitmaker went into a tirade.
“No! Not good morning! You already know. Why are you here?” Before Bieber went on a rant about “money, money, money, money”.
He continued: “Get outta here, bro. Money, that’s all you want. You don’t care about human beings.
“That’s all you care about, guys. Is money. You don’t care about people. Only money. … You don’t care about human beings.”
The latest controversy hasn’t done much to quell any rumours about Bieber’s mental wellbeing; “Wtf is happening with Justin Bieber”, being just one tweet which was shared hundreds of times.
What the downfall of P Diddy means for Justin Bieber
The general level of concern around Bieber has been heightened since the P Diddy scandal broke last summer. After the rap mogul was charged with sex trafficking and racketeering, countless hours of old footage were uncovered showing concerning behaviour by Diddy in hindsight.
One of the biggest targets of this online evidence excavation was Justin Bieber, who was placed under Diddy’s “custody” while still a young teenager and introduced to his world.

Speaking to the camera in the 2009 video, which is still live on Bieber’s YouTube channel, Diddy says: “He’s having 48 hours with Diddy, where we hanging out and what we’re doing we can’t really disclose. But it’s definitely a 15-year-old’s dream. I have been given custody of him.
“He’s signed to Usher when he did his first album. I don’t really have legal guardianship of him, but for the next 48 hours he’s with me. And we’re gonna go buck fool crazy.”
What we really know about what Justin Bieber is doing now
In the here and now, Bieber has yet to release any music since 2023, with his last studio album, Justice having launched in 2021. He occasionally pops up on tracks, including the acoustic version of SZA’s Snooze and hit The Kid Laroi single Stay, but Bieber’s presence in the music industry is increasingly becoming Rihanna-esque (i.e, non-existent).

But should people really be that worried? Much of the speculation around Bieber is fuelled by his gaunt physicality and his outfit choices, but to some extent, Bieber has always dressed like this. In adulthood, at least.
His looks have caused fans to speculate about his personal life for years, which anyone will be able to recall if they remember the strange period of time where he got really into wearing hotel slippers out onto the street. And as for the gauntness, well: Bieber did become a first time father seven months ago. Perhaps he is just tired like any other new parent and doesn’t have time to overthink his outfits.
Meanwhile, he and Bieber are consistently making public appearances that conflict with the divorce rumours and Bieber’s music return is heavily slated for 2025.
Which begs the question: could Justin Bieber just be... being Justin Bieber?
